WebbThe longitudinal lateral incision is the standard approach for most lateral fractures. If access to the anterior syndesmosis is required, or a lag screw from anterior to posterior (Chaput lesion) is planned, place the incision slightly anteriorly. Make a 10-15 cm incision in line with the fibula, centered over the fracture. WebbTibial Shaft. Webb7 feb. 2024 · The fibula and tibia run parallel to each other in the leg and are similar in length but the fibula is much thinner than the tibia. This is indicative of the weight-bearing contributions of each bone.
